| Description | Epithelial cell adhesion molecule (EpCAM) is a transmembrane glycoprotein.1 It is composed of an extracellular domain (EpEX) that contains an N-domain, a thyroglobulin type-IA domain, and a C-domain, a transmembrane domain, and an intracellular domain (EpIC). EpEX undergoes proteolytic cleavage by disintegrin and metalloproteinase domain-containing protein 17 (ADAM17/TACE) to release soluble EpEX, and γ-secretase cleaves EpCAM at two sites to release a soluble extracellular amyloid-β-like fragment and EpIC. EpCAM is ubiquitously expressed in epithelial tissues but is also found in stem and progenitor cells and tight junctions.2,3 It is involved in cell adhesion, transport, polarity, proliferation, and motility and signals through novel PKC (nPKC), Wnt, and embryonic RAS (ERAS)/Akt pathways.2 Knockdown of EPCAM decreases proliferation, migration, and invasion of breast cancer cells in vitro.4 Epcam-/- mice develop congenital tufting enteropathy (CTE), a disease characterized by hemorrhagic diarrhea, colon crypt hyperplasia, intestinal tufts, and villous atrophy.5 Increased protein levels of EpCAM are frequently found in tumors from patients with diverse cancer types.6 Cayman’s EpCAM Rabbit Monoclonal Antibody (Clone 28) can be used for ELISA, ELISA (detection), flow cytometry (FC), immunocytochemistry (ICC), immunofluorescence (IF), immunohistochemistry paraffin (IHC-P), immunoprecipitation (IP), and Western blot (WB) applications. The antibody recognizes EpCAM at 34 kDa from human samples.
